编程语言ac是什么意思

fiy 其他 22

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程语言AC是指"Assembly Code",即汇编语言的简称。汇编语言是一种与计算机硬件架构密切相关的低级编程语言,用于直接控制计算机的指令集。与高级编程语言相比,汇编语言更接近计算机底层的操作,可以直接操作寄存器、内存和其他硬件资源。汇编语言的代码是由一系列特定的机器指令组成,每个指令对应着一条特定的操作。通过使用汇编语言,程序员可以更加精确地控制计算机的运行,实现更高效的程序。

    汇编语言是一种面向机器的语言,与不同的计算机体系结构密切相关。因此,每种计算机体系结构都有自己特定的汇编语言。程序员需要了解特定计算机体系结构的指令集,才能编写相应的汇编代码。汇编语言相对于高级编程语言来说更加底层,需要程序员对计算机硬件的工作原理有较深入的理解。

    尽管汇编语言相对于高级编程语言来说更加复杂和繁琐,但它也有其独特的优势。由于汇编语言直接操作硬件资源,可以实现高度优化的代码,提高程序的执行效率。同时,汇编语言还可以直接访问底层的硬件功能,如操作系统接口、外设控制等,为程序员提供更大的灵活性和控制力。

    总而言之,汇编语言是一种底层的编程语言,用于直接控制计算机硬件。它虽然复杂,但具有高效和灵活的特点,可以实现对计算机的精确控制。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程语言AC是指"Assembly Code"(汇编语言)的缩写。汇编语言是一种与计算机硬件密切相关的低级语言,它直接操作计算机的寄存器和内存单元,用于编写底层的系统程序和驱动程序。

    以下是关于汇编语言AC的几个重要点:

    1. 与机器语言密切相关:汇编语言是与特定计算机体系结构紧密相关的语言。每个计算机体系结构都有自己的汇编语言。汇编语言的指令直接对应于计算机硬件的操作码,因此可以直接与硬件进行交互。

    2. 低级语言:汇编语言是一种低级语言,与高级语言相比,它更加接近计算机硬件。汇编语言指令的语法和操作码通常以机器指令的形式表示,对于初学者来说,阅读和编写汇编代码可能会更加复杂和困难。

    3. 直接操作硬件:汇编语言允许程序员直接访问和操作计算机的寄存器和内存。通过使用特定的汇编指令,程序员可以读取和修改寄存器中的值,将数据加载到内存中,以及执行各种算术和逻辑操作。

    4. 用于系统编程:由于汇编语言可以直接操作硬件,因此它通常用于编写底层的系统程序和驱动程序。操作系统、嵌入式系统和设备驱动程序等通常需要与硬件直接交互,因此使用汇编语言可以提供更高的性能和更精确的控制。

    5. 可移植性差:由于汇编语言与特定的计算机体系结构相关,因此不同的计算机体系结构需要使用不同的汇编语言。这意味着在不同的计算机上,相同的汇编代码可能需要进行修改和适应才能运行。与高级语言相比,汇编语言的可移植性较差。

    总结起来,汇编语言AC是一种低级语言,用于直接操作计算机硬件。它主要用于编写底层的系统程序和驱动程序,提供更高的性能和更精确的控制。然而,由于与特定的计算机体系结构相关,汇编语言的可移植性较差。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程语言AC是指Ada语言(Ada language)。Ada是一种高级、静态类型、并发性强的编程语言,最初由美国国防部为了取代各种各样的编程语言而开发的。它是一种面向对象的编程语言,具有良好的可读性和可维护性。

    Ada语言的设计目标是为了支持软件工程中大型、高度可靠的系统的开发。它的设计考虑了安全性、可靠性、可扩展性和可移植性等方面的需求。Ada语言具有严格的语法规则和类型检查,以确保编写出高质量、可靠的代码。

    以下是Ada语言的一些特点和主要特性:

    1. 静态类型:Ada是一种静态类型语言,所有变量在编译时必须被声明并指定其类型。这种类型检查可以在编译时捕捉到很多错误,提高了代码的可靠性。

    2. 并发性:Ada语言内置了对并发编程的支持,包括任务(task)和任务类型(task type)。任务可以并行执行,提高了程序的性能。

    3. 强类型:Ada是一种强类型语言,要求变量在使用之前必须进行类型转换。这样可以避免类型不匹配的错误,增加了代码的安全性。

    4. 可移植性:Ada语言具有很好的可移植性,可以在不同的硬件平台和操作系统上运行。它定义了一套标准的库和API,使得开发的程序可以在不同的环境中进行移植。

    5. 面向对象:虽然Ada语言不是一种纯粹的面向对象语言,但它支持面向对象的编程风格。它提供了封装、继承和多态等特性,可以用于开发面向对象的应用程序。

    总之,Ada语言是一种强大而可靠的编程语言,适用于开发大型、高度可靠的系统。它具有丰富的特性和功能,可以提高软件开发的效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部